Abstract
Speckle noise reduction techniques are very important for the enhancement and preprocessing of SAR and many medical images. We present a fast and efficient algorithm, based on fractal convolutions, to reduce speckle noise in real SAR images. The results of this approach are compared with other classical noise reduction techniques.
